VB6.0 Win XPで開発を行っています。
現在2台のPCをイーサネットで接続し、この2台のPC間での通信の手段を検討しています。
送信する情報は、メッセージとファイルデータ(テキストデータ)です。
具体的な実現手段として現在思いついた方法は
<メッセージ>
1.Winsockを利用したソケット通信
2.メッセージ送信用のDCOMを自作する
<ファイル>
1.Winsockを利用したファイルの送信
2.Inetコントロールを利用したFTP通信
3.basp21のファイル送信を利用
知識がなく、このぐらいしか思いつきません。
もし他に何か手段があればどなたかアドバイスいただけませんか?
よろしくお願いいたします。
その他というとこんなところでしょうか?
共有フォルダの読み書きだけで何とかする
ネットワーク対応のRDBMSを使う
Webサーバを立てる
全てメールでなんとかする
名前付きパイプ
メッセージを送信すると言うのは何に対して、何を送信
するのでしょうか?
送信先はFTPサーバーなんですか?
ひろさま、我龍院忠太さま、ご返答ありがとうございます。
メッセージ内容はString型又はInteger型の単純なメッセージです。
ただし、メッセージ送信はポーリングに利用したいため
接続の確実性と速度が重要になります。
PCにFTPサーバは立てていません。
なるべく単純な構成にしたいので
できればサーバをたてるのは避けたいのですが
場合によってはそれも仕方ないかなと考えております。
一応可能性としていろいろ考えてみたのですが
Winsockを利用するのが一番早く確実そうですね。
| ツイート |
|